Question I feel like my hamster doesn't like me

First off, I'm not entirely sure this is a behavioral thing but I don't know what other category this would go under.
Basically, I have never been a hamster owner up until recently. I'm more of a rat person. You see, my pet rat, Noodle, passed away recently so my friends decided to get me a hamster to help me go through her death.
Noodle, and every other rat of mine in the past, would always love to cuddle. I read online and it said hamsters enjoy cuddling too.
And I know not every hamster is the same, but mine just wants to run from me all the time. She never settles down. Never wants to cuddle. I've had her for about a month now.
Any time I take her out for her to play she wants to find a way to escape.
Any time I put her in her hamster ball she tries to chew her way out.
All she does is sleep and try to escape

Is it something I'm doing? Does she just need time to get used to me? Or is it just what hamsters do?

Sorry for the loss of your rat, Noodle.

I don't associate the word "cuddle" with hamsters, although many may eventually get to that stage. My current little guy is quite mellow in temperament and will sit comfortably in my hands, but I think he prefers to explore and run around. Mid-day if he comes out of his house for food, he appears to enjoy being petted while he eats, and then he returns to his house to sleep. They are solitary creatures by nature whereas rats are known to be more social.

However, hamsters are still very enjoyable pets. What type of hamster do you have?

If she is trying to get out of her ball by chewing, I would stop using the ball. Whilst my hamsters pretty much won't stay still and be cuddled (unless they are very sleepy an djust woken up), if I lay down or sit on the floor whilst they are free roaming they will not leave me alone, running up and all over me. Maybe that's something you could do with your hamster?

She may need longer to adapt to her new home, everything from smells, noises, voices will have an affect on her. Not all hamsters want to be cuddled, it's important that she gets use to your scent and voice so be sure to talk to her at every opportunity even if she can't be seen.

The longest my hamster ever sat still for cuddling was about 5 minutes. Once. I've had him 9 months now. He is always busy, looking around checking in this corner, that corner, running up and down places. But I sit in the bathtub with him where he can't escape, and he loves to run all over me, climbing up to my shoulder, even the top of my head, then sliding back down. So I get my cuddles sort of indirectly, because he's almost always on the move.
